3. Entrepreneurship Can Promote Social Changes 

Entrepreneurs change or break the tradition or cultures of society and reduce the dependency on obsolete methods, systems, and technologies. Basically, entrepreneurs are the pioneer of bringing new technologies and systems that ultimately bring changes to society. These changes are associated with improved lifestyle, generous thinking, better morale, and higher economic choice. In this way, social changes gradually impact national and global changes. So the importance of social entrepreneurship must be appreciated. 

At Duke, the Innovation and Entrepreneurship Initiative has a special program aimed specifically at Social Innovation. The program is “building upon and extending the strengths of the university to create a transformational learning environment to inspire, prepare, and support entrepreneurial leaders and scholars to turn knowledge into action in pursuing innovative solutions to the world’s most pressing problems.” 

For example, one of the most recent projects of the initiative is the Duke-UNICEF Innovation Accelerator, which is focused on entrepreneurship for menstrual health and hygiene for women and girls in vulnerable communities in three African countries.

5. Entrepreneurship Develops and Improves Existing Enterprises

We often think of entrepreneurs as inventing totally new products and ideas, but they also impact existing business. Since entrepreneurs think differently, they can come up with innovative ways to expand and develop the existing enterprises. For example, modernizing production processes, implementing new technology in the overall distribution and marketing processes, and helping the existing enterprises to utilize existing resources in more efficient ways.  

To sum up, supporting and promoting entrepreneurship can have a positive impact on the country’s economy and even existing businesses, and social entrepreneurship increases the likelihood of finding innovation solutions to social challenges faced by communities around the world.

What are the 3S in the entrepreneurial process?

Baron (2004a:170) names the three stages of the entrepreneurship process as screening ideas for feasibility; assembling needed resources; and actually developing a new business.

What are the 3S of opportunity choose one and explain?

8. SEEKING, SCREENING, and SEIZING 3S of Opportunity Spotting and Assessment is the framework that most of the promising entrepreneurs use to finally come up with the ultimate product or service suited for specific opportunity.
